Network Working Group 14 July 1971 Request for Comments: 193 E. Harslem - Rand NIC 7138 J. Heafner - Rand

                          NETWORK CHECKOUT
  As of 15 July we had contacted or been contacted by the sites

listed below. The matrix indicates the elements of Network software we have verified at each site.

Notes

 SRI-10:   The Telnet-like protocol differs from Telnet in
           that lines are terminated by X'OD' rather than
           X'ODOA'.  John Melvin will have it fixed by
           the time you read this.

 LL-67:    Joel Winett telles me NCP, ICP, EBCDIC, Telnet and
           access to a virtual 360 are working.  Due to hard-
           ware difficulties we have not verified this.
 BBN-10:   Same difference as SRI with respect to Telnet.
           Under certain conditions, the ICP generates a
           zero byte size.  Ray Tomlinson tells me these
           idiosyncracies will be taken care of in about
           a week.  Three sites have commented that TENEX
           assigns the same local socket to multiple connec-
           tions, when acting as a server.  Ray says that
           this is the design -- not an error.  BBN TENEX
           is currently being used productively via the
           Net, for some non-Network related problems.
 UTAH:     Our tests with UTAH were pre-TENEX.  TENEX is
           currently being installed at UTAH.
 MIT-645:  Our understanding is that most software is
           working; we have not verified this.
